Points (2,2) and (2,7) lie on line z. What is the

slope of the line that is parallel to z?

Answer: undefined.

Step-by-step explanation:

Slope of a line having points (a,b) and (c,d) :

[tex]slope =\dfrac{d-b}{c-a}[/tex]

Given : Point of line z =  (2,2) and (2,7)

Slope of line z : [tex]\dfrac{7-2}{2-2}=\dfrac{5}{0}=\infty[/tex]

Hence, the slope of line z is undefined.

Since , the slope of two parallel lines are same.

Therefore ,the slope of the line parallel  to line z is undefined.
